#1ca4a2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1ca4a2 is composed of 11% red, 64.3%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.2%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 179.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#1ca4a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#004945.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#1ca4a2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1ca4a2 has RGB values of R:28, G:164,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 1877154.

Hex triplet 1ca4a2 #1ca4a2
RGB Decimal 28, 164, 162 rgb(28,164,162)
RGB Percent 11, 64.3, 63.5 rgb(11%,64.3%,63.5%)
CMYK 83, 0, 1, 36
HSL 179.1°, 70.8, 37.6 hsl(179.1,70.8%,37.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 179.1°, 82.9, 64.3
Web Safe 339999 #339999
CIE-LAB 61.137, -33.74, -8.783
XYZ 20.274, 29.404, 38.788
xyY 0.229, 0.332, 29.404
CIE-LCH 61.137, 34.865, 194.591
CIE-LUV 61.137, -45.671, -8.144
Hunter-Lab 54.226, -28.158, -4.452
Binary 00011100, 10100100, 10100010

Shades and Tints of #1ca4a2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0d is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ca4a2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6261 is the less saturated color, while #06bab8 is the most saturated one.
